How much do software test j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for software test in Payson, UT is $49.60,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$43.56 and $56.15 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a software tester,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Software Tester, you need a strong understanding of software development life cycles, test case design, and quality assurance principles, typically backed by a degree in computer science or related experience. Familiarity with test management tools (like JIRA or TestRail), automation frameworks (such as Selenium), and certifications like ISTQB are highly valued. Attention to detail, analytical thinking, and effective communication help testers identify bugs and collaborate with developers. These skills ensure reliable, high-quality software, reduced defects, and successful project outcomes.

What are some common challenges software test professionals face when collaborating with development teams?

Software test professionals frequently encounter challenges such as communication gaps, differing project priorities, and tight deadlines when working with development teams. It's important to maintain clear and ongoing communication to ensure that requirements and bug reports are fully understood. Regular meetings, shared documentation, and using collaborative tools like Jira or Slack can help bridge gaps and foster a more cohesive workflow. Building trust and mutual respect between testing and development teams is key to efficiently identifying and resolving issues, leading to higher-quality software releases.

What is a software test?

Software test jobs involve evaluating and verifying that software applications function as intended. Professionals in this field, often called software testers or quality assurance (QA) engineers, design and execute tests to identify bugs, usability issues, or security vulnerabilities before products are released. They may use automated tools, manual testing methods, or a combination of both to ensure product quality. Effective software testers help improve software reliability and user satisfaction by catching issues early in the development process.
